Sales and Market Bullets
- Lawyer and environmental activist David Boyd draws on his wealth of legal expertise and knowledge of environmental crises to create a riveting eco-thriller filled with courtroom drama.
- For readers of John Grisham looking for new voices and a tense and believable trial involving trending topics.
- Book club questions will be available.
